The HR software market in 2026 is no longer defined by simple record-keeping but by 'workforce orchestration.' Our analysis of the current AI recommendation landscape reveals a significant shift in how platforms like ChatGPT, Claude, and Gemini evaluate HRIS (Human Resources Information Systems). AI models are increasingly prioritizing platforms that offer deep automation of the employee lifecycle rather than those that simply serve as a database of record. For HR teams, this means the 'best' software is now judged by its ability to reduce administrative overhead through AI-driven workflows and cross-departmental data synchronization.
Key Takeaway
Rippling and Workday have emerged as the dominant recommendations across all AI platforms, though for fundamentally different reasons: Rippling for its middleware-like automation and Workday for its unparalleled enterprise data depth.

Rippling
strong
- Unified workforce platform
- Automated device management
- Deep integration ecosystem
Considerations: Premium pricing; Can be complex for very small teams
Workday
strong
- Enterprise-grade analytics
- Global scalability
- Advanced talent management
Considerations: High implementation costs; Steep learning curve
BambooHR
moderate
- User-friendly interface
- Strong culture tools
- Efficient onboarding
Considerations: Limited advanced payroll features; Integration gaps for large enterprises
Gusto
moderate
- Exceptional payroll UX
- Benefits administration
- Compliance automation
Considerations: Primarily US-focused; Less robust for high-headcount firms
Deel
moderate
- Global EOR services
- International compliance
- Contractor management
Considerations: Niche focus on global teams; Less depth in traditional HRIS features
ADP Workforce Now
moderate
- Unmatched compliance history
- Comprehensive reporting
- Scalability
Considerations: Legacy UI issues; Complex pricing structures

Frequently Asked Questions
Which HR software is most recommended for automation?
Rippling is the clear consensus leader for automation, particularly for its ability to sync HR data with IT and Finance departments automatically.
Is Workday still the best choice for large enterprises?
Yes, AI platforms consistently rank Workday as the gold standard for organizations with over 5,000 employees due to its robust analytics and global reach.
